Job description

Hydroforce Cleaning & Restoration is seeking an experienced and motivated Mitigation Project Manager / Estimator to join our growing team.
This position is responsible for managing water, fire, and mold restoration projects from the initial inspection through mitigation completion. The Project Manager will be the first point of contact for the customer, develop the scope of work, prepare estimates, and oversee field crews throughout the project.
Responsibilities
  • Perform detailed inspections of residential and commercial water, fire, and mold losses
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for customers throughout the mitigation process
  • Determine the appropriate mitigation scope of work
  • Perform moisture inspections and identify affected building materials
  • Prepare accurate estimates using Xactimate
  • Create detailed work orders and scopes for field crews
  • Coordinate manpower, equipment, and job requirements
  • Direct and oversee mitigation crews throughout the project
  • Monitor job progress and ensure work is completed according to scope
  • Maintain accurate photos, notes, moisture documentation, and job files
  • Communicate with property owners, insurance adjusters, agents, property managers, and other involved parties
  • Identify changes in scope and prepare supplements when necessary
  • Ensure projects are completed efficiently, professionally, and within company standards
  • Ensure customer satisfaction throughout the restoration process
Qualifications
  • Restoration industry experience required
  • Water mitigation experience required
  • Ability to independently inspect and scope property damage
  • Xactimate experience strongly preferred
  • Strong understanding of structural drying and mitigation procedures
  • IICRC WRT certification preferred
  • Strong leadership and crew-management skills
  • Excellent communication and organizational skills
  • Ability to manage multiple active projects simultaneously
  • Professional appearance and customer-focused attitude
  • Valid driver's license
